If y varies inversely as x and y = 2 when x = 1, find x when y is 4

Answer:

[tex]x=\frac{1}{2}[/tex]

Step-by-step explanation:

If y varies inversely as x , then;

[tex]y=\frac{k}{x}[/tex]

where k is the constant of variation;

When x=1, y=2,

[tex]2=\frac{k}{1}[/tex]

This implies that;

k=2

The variation equation is

[tex]y=\frac{2}{x}[/tex]

When y=4,

[tex]4=\frac{2}{x}[/tex]

[tex]x=\frac{2}{4}[/tex]

[tex]x=\frac{1}{2}[/tex]
